Block 384,342
Block Hash
d3f903fc4beda4820846905e4746a2714c98e3597063325959476d8bf097f64c
Previous Block Hash
d7f38e4ef3da610ea4c1077218ca28a3c1eba88ea098ab0800d772307e90b969
Mined
Transactions
3
Difficulty
24.95 M
Size
624 bytes
Transactions (3)
1 input, 1 output
62,500.00452
PEPE
1 input, 2 outputs
558,922.21122
PEPE
1 input, 2 outputs
558,917.20896
PEPE